Islam guarantees basic human rights, says PAS veep
Islam has, for the 1,400 years of its existence, set out a strong and solid foundation of governing a multi-racial, multi-religious society based on principles of human rights found in the Quran.
Terengganu state exco member Mustafa Ali said Islam ensures the safety of life, chastity of women and their right to be protected, rights to basic needs, freedom and justice, equality of human beings, and their right to cooperate or not with one another.
He said the premise for basic human rights in the Islamic system of governance forms an important foundation in establishing a just society, where everybody is treated equally.
Mustafa, who is also a PAS vice-president, said the rights are extended to both Muslims and people of other faiths.
